AMSTERDAM — 7 August, 2023 — WeTransfer, a leading provider of creative productivity tools, marks its three year anniversary as a certified B Corporation with the launch of a coloring book. 

Downloadable for free via WeTransfer, the coloring book was created by five illustrators curated by its award-winning arts arm WePresent. Each illustration addresses a crucial social and environmental issue including climate justice, community, LGBTQIA+ representation, mental health, and accessibility. 

  • Climate Justice

Maria Jesus Contreras — The South American-based graphic designer and illustrator was chosen for her colorful and nostalgic style, inspiring action and raising awareness about the climate crisis and its impact on marginalised communities.

  • Community

Rakhmat Jaka Perkasa  — The South Borneo-based graphic designer and illustrator, emphasizes the importance of preserving and protecting local communities.

  • LGBTQIA+

Sioe Jeng Tsao  — The Amsterdam based queer Neurodivergent Illustrator & Writer, they raise awareness and give a voice to those who are often overlooked.

  • Mental health

Ori Toor  — The Tel-Aviv-based illustrator is known for his creative freestyle world aesthetic and symbolically dense illustrations. 

  • Accessibility

Tara Booth  — The Portland-based comic book artist highlighting accessibility as an often invisible topic and raising awareness about invisible disabilities like anxiety.

Lina Ruiz, Director of Corporate Social Responsibility at WeTransfer, "Since the beginning, WeTransfer has donated 30% of our advertising inventory to artists and social causes because we believe in the power that creativity has to change the world. 85% of WeTransfer's customers say they love books, and 77% are concerned with the environment and planet. So to celebrate three years of being a certified B Corporation, we created a coloring book that our community of users could download for free, acting as a reminder of creativity's role in raising awareness for critical global issues."

About WeTransfer

WeTransfer streamlines the workflow process for millions of creative professionals. Its ecosystem of creative productivity tools makes it easy to collaborate, share and deliver work. WeTransfer has more than 80 million monthly active users in 190 countries. As a certified B Corporation™, WeTransfer has long been a champion of using business as a force for good. Since its founding in 2009, WeTransfer has donated up to 30% of its advertising space to support artists and social causes. Last year, WeTransfer also launched its Supporting Act Foundation to support emerging creative talent through arts education, grants, and an annual prize.

About WePresent

WePresent is WeTransfer’s arts platform, acting as the company’s cultural torchbearer to a monthly audience of approximately 3 million in 190 countries. Collaborating with emerging young talent to renowned artists such as Marina Abramović, Riz Ahmed, FKA twigs or David Sedaris, WePresent showcases the best in art, photography, film, music, literature and more, championing diversity in everything it does. The platform’s commissions range from editorial features to films, illustrations, photography series, events, and exhibitions, with an aim to offer a fresh take on the magic and mystery of creative ideas. WePresent were the commissioners and Executive Producers of the acclaimed short film “The Long Goodbye” by actor and musician Riz Ahmed and director Aneil Karia, which won an Oscar in 2022 for Best Live Action Short Film.
